Broken Seals
A broken window seal may result in windows becoming foggy, which can reduce the energy efficiency of your home. It's important to call an expert in window repair immediately when your windows start to mist up and create drafts. Along with reducing the efficiency of your home's energy usage damaged window seals could cause water damage in your living space.
Modern double or multi-paned windows have both inner and outer seals that prevent humid air from seeping between the glass panes. These windows are commonly referred to as insulated glass units or IGUs. These windows contain inert gases like argon or Krypton, that increase the insulation value. This inert gases helps to keep warm air in and cold air out during the winter.
While window seals are made to last for a long time, they can break. The window seal could be damaged by many different things, such as heat guns used by home artists to strip paint, as well as high winds that put pressure on windows.
Natural house settlement is another common reason for a broken window seal. This shifting can cause the frame to shift a little, putting pressure on the window seal. This kind of issue is usually only temporary, however it is important to inspect the window seal regularly for indications of wear and wear and tear.
In certain situations windows, the seals can be resealed and not replace the entire glass unit, which is called an insulated glass unit (IGU). Resealing double-paned window requires defogging and resealing around the IGU. It can be done within an hour or two, and is inexpensive. This is not a DIY project since it requires specialized tools for the resealing of the glass using an insulating argon or krypton.
You can also use caulk as an adhesive between the window frame and the sash. However, it's important to remember that caulk is not a type of seal than an IGU inner seal and is not intended to replace it.

Misting
Misted double glazing is a frequent issue for those with new double glazing. This is because windows are generally filled with Argon gas between the two glass panes for increased thermal efficiency. This gas helps regulate temperature of the room by keeping warm air inside the room and cold air out. As time passes, this gas will degrade or lose its insulation capabilities. This is the reason why a mist forms between the window's panes.
You can fix this problem in most cases without having to replace the entire window unit. You can call an expert to take the unit apart, clean any condensation, and double glazing repairs near me thoroughly clean the glass panes to eliminate the moisture and dust. After this, they can restore and secure the window.
The most common causes for this issue include drying clothes in the bathroom, using steam irons and not opening the kitchen windows while cooking or washing dishes. All of these factors can cause steam, which may later cool and then turn into condensation.
It is important to contact an expert if you spot condensation on your double-glazed windows. This will allow you to avoid further damage. If you leave the issue unattended, it can cause the growth of mould and mildew which can be a health hazard for you and your family. Additionally, the excess moisture that gets trapped between the panes can also impact your insulation and make your house more expensive to heat as the warm air is forced out through the windows.
